Section D: Disassembly Procedure (Step-by-Step)

This is the core of the manual. It includes: Compressor Module : The compressor module is the

  1. Recovery of refrigerant and oil.
  2. Removal of suction and discharge flanges.
  3. Extraction of the slide valve actuator.
  4. Unbolting the motor end cover (using hydraulic tensioners or specified torque patterns).
  5. Removing the rotor assembly as a unit.
